Output 42905657ba4ec95542d79ab7d15669f49b2e8c22b1e649b8d066933187dd86dc:0

value
5300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fddaf5a5b87c06c320271614f0c98aa604e31f9d OP_EQUAL
address
3QqHBesbLhYj7DCgYv4S2mLTCKghLsNTfS
transaction
42905657ba4ec95542d79ab7d15669f49b2e8c22b1e649b8d066933187dd86dc
spent
true